EJUL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

53 of the 6,301 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Innovator Emerging Markets Power Buffer ETF July (EJUL)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$61.5M — up 43% from $42.9M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 15 funds opened new EJUL positions and 7 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 23 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Gradient Investments, opening a new position worth an estimated $13.6M. The largest seller was Cerity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$16.5M sold.
